Literacy skills are one of the most important areas of ability children develop in their first few years at schoolhouse. They begin past sounding out words and learning to recognize common vocabulary from books and classroom materials. With sight reading and spelling practise comes greater fluency.

Reading speeds up and comprehension of more complex texts becomes possible as vocabulary knowledge grows exponentially. However, not all students find learning to read such an easy procedure. Struggling readers can quickly fall behind their peers and may develop low self-esteem and a lack of confidence as a consequence.

Because reading ability impacts performance beyond all areas of the curriculum, including writing skills, it'due south important to provide adequate strategy training equally early equally possible. Ideally remediation is tailored to the individual educatee's needs, particularly when a learning difficulty is involved.

Different learning difficulties impact on fluency in reading merely ane of the near common conditions is dyslexia. If a pupil has poor reading skills and a somewhat inconsistent approach to spelling –they recognize or produce a word correctly one day but not the next-- dyslexia may be involved.

At that place are many types but effectually lxx% of students with dyslexia struggle to divide words into their component sounds. It is this lack of phonemic awareness that prevents the authentic sound-alphabetic character mapping which is required for spelling and decoding in early reading. Some kids take trouble focusing their attending on the books or classroom worksheets they are meant to be reading. For students with attention related learning difficulties, including attention deficit disorder and attention deficit disorder with hyperactivity, the challenge is not so much in sounding out the words but concentrating long enough to procedure what they are reading.

Sitting still and controlling impulsive tendencies tin can also be problematic, particularly for students with ADHD. What's crucial is that teachers recognize the root of the problem early on and find strategies to assistance enhance focus during reading sessions. 1 idea is choosing a regular time of day when the student is almost calm, maybe later on an outside practise break. It's also a good idea to reduce distractions and create a quiet infinite where they tin go to read on their own.

Parents and teachers may find reading fluency is defective in individuals with slow processing. This is because the encephalon requires more than time to comport out the circuitous cognitive processes involved in reading, from word recognition to comprehension.

Patience, time and more time may be the solution hither. In some instances, a student tin appear to read fluently simply not actually sympathize what he or she is reading. Decoding & comprehension

Reading is a circuitous cognitive task that involves parallel activity in different areas of the brain. Readers must decode the messages on a page, recognize the words they are fabricated up of and brand meaning out of groups of words, sentences and paragraphs. Issues concerning reading fluency can stalk from decoding skills, comprehension skills or both. Learn more in common reading problems.

Decoding

This is the process of recognizing letters and words and sounding them out. Decoding is easier said than done in English, a linguistic communication in which multiple letters can be used to represent the same sounds. The only fashion to finer learn how to pronounce common vowel and consonant clusters is to accept seen them earlier. This is one reason why learning to touch on-type and drill letter combinations on a keyboard helps struggling readers. Comprehension

Fluency can likewise be impacted by a failure to understand what is existence read. Readers are required to concord a number of details and contextual clues in memory in order to make connections and option upwardly on gist, inference and main ideas in the text. If comprehension is a struggle it can interrupt fluency as students notice they cannot follow what they are reading and need to go back to re-read earlier parts of the text. In the same way, focusing also much on decoding can prevent struggling readers from paying attending to the content of a reading.

10 Strategies for fluency

  1. Record students reading aloud on their own. If certain sound-letter combinations or words are causing problems, teachers volition benefit from listening to the child read out loud. Notwithstanding, this activeness can be extremely stressful in front of a classroom of kids, especially for a student who struggles with fluency. Information technology is all-time to avert calling on struggling readers during group reading and instead have them piece of work through a paragraph on their own. Brand a recording that can be analysed afterwards on past a teacher or tutor in order to provide targeted help.

  2. Ask kids to utilize a ruler or finger to follow along. Decoding is easier when students don't lose their place as they motion across a page. Information technology's up to the individual pupil how they get about this. Some may want to use a pen or pencil, others a slice of newspaper that they move downwardly to cover the bottom of the page and stay focused on the sentence in forepart of them. This is also a good strategy for readers with ADHD considering information technology involves a kinaesthetic chemical element.

  3. Have them read the same thing several times. When you're trying to improve fluency, it helps to see the same text multiple times. Each reading becomes easier and motivation goes upward as students experience enhanced fluency thank you to repeat exposure to words and phrases. It can likewise help when information technology comes to developing comprehension skills as readers take more opportunities to observe contextual cues.

  4. Pre-teach vocabulary. Prime the words a student is going to come across in a text and practice reading them in isolation or in phrases. You might practise this via an interactive classroom based activity. Go students to utilise the words and so exercise reading them from the board or on a slice of paper. Crossword puzzles tin be an constructive education tool or playing a spelling game. It's much easier to read a word if it is fresh in memory.

  5. Drill sight words. Some words are more common than others and students who have a hard time with fluency volition observe it is much easier to read when they are familiar with xc% of the vocabulary in a text. Around 50% of all books and classroom based materials for immature readers are composed of words from the Dolch Listing. Acquire more in our post on pedagogy sight words.

  6. Make use of a variety of books and materials. If a student has difficulty with reading information technology can be even more of a struggle to practice with material that is not of interest to them. Sometimes all it takes is getting readers excited virtually a topic to help them lose themselves in the activity. Attempt chapter books, comics and poems. Even motion-picture show books can piece of work every bit long as the student doesn't perceive the material as being below their level. Experiment with texts of dissimilar lengths starting with shorter textile and gradually working upwards to longer pieces.Acme TIP: Where fluency is concerned the emphasis is on the quality of the educatee's reading, non the quantity of pages or speed at which they read them.

  7. Try different font and text sizes. If there's a visual impairment that is causing some of the difficulty, reading larger text or text printed on colour tinted paper can sometimes make things easier. There are specific fonts which are more appropriate for anyone with learning difficulties, including dyslexia, because they aid with discerning messages and decoding language.

  8. Create a stress free surround. When students are enjoying a volume, anxiety and stress are reduced and fluency is enhanced. It'due south also possible to foster a relaxing surround past removing whatever deadlines, time-limits or assessment related goals and only focusing on classroom reading for reading's sake.

  9. Guide students to help them establish a steady footstep. One of the hallmarks of fluent reading is establishing a consequent rhythm and stride that guides students through a text. This doesn't need to be fast and in the showtime new readers should have the choice to beginning irksome and increase their pace every bit they become more comfortable. Some students will want to have a guide, such every bit a metronome, which gives them a rhythm they can lucifer. Others will find this strategy stressful. Playing music in the background might likewise piece of work – or not!
